How to Search for Files in Windows 11

Follow these steps to search for files in Windows 11. This will help you quickly and efficiently locate any file on your system.

Step 1: Start by Opening the Start Menu

Click on the Start menu button located at the bottom-left corner of your screen.

This is the button with the Windows logo. Once clicked, it’ll open up a menu where you can start typing your search query instantly.

Step 2: Type Your Search Query

Begin typing the name of the file or a keyword related to it in the search bar.

As you type, Windows 11 will automatically start searching for files that match your query. This includes documents, images, apps, and more.

Step 3: Review the Search Results

Look through the search results displayed below the search bar.

Windows 11 categorizes results by file type, making it easier for you to locate specific types of files. If your file doesn’t show up, try refining your search terms.

Step 4: Use Advanced Search Options

Click on “More” to access advanced search options for narrowing down results by file type, date modified, and more.

Advanced search options offer a more refined search. You can filter results to show only documents, photos, apps, or other categories, making pinpointing the exact file you need much simpler.

Step 5: Open the File

Once you find the file, click on it to open it directly from the search results.

This action will instantly open the file in the appropriate application. It saves you the time of navigating through folders manually.

Tips for Searching for Files in Windows 11

  • Use Specific Keywords: The more specific your search terms, the more accurate your results will be.
  • Utilize Filters: Filters such as date modified or file type can drastically narrow down your search.
  • Check Different Categories: Results are categorized by type (documents, photos, etc.). Make sure you check each relevant category.
  • Rename Files Sensibly: Naming files with clear, descriptive names can make future searches more straightforward.
  • Regularly Clean Up Files: Keep your files organized in folders, which makes the search function even more effective.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I search for hidden files?

In the search bar, type the file name and include “hidden” as a keyword. Ensure that hidden files are set to be visible in your file explorer settings.

Can I search for files within specific folders?

Yes, you can open File Explorer, navigate to the folder in question, and then use the search bar within that window.

What if I can’t find a file using the search function?

If a file doesn’t appear, try checking your Recycle Bin or use a broader search term. Also, ensure the file hasn’t been hidden or moved to an external storage device.

Can I search for files by date?

Yes, you can. Use the advanced search options to filter files by the date they were modified or created.

How do I search for apps specifically?

Simply type the app’s name in the Start menu search bar. Windows 11 will prioritize apps in the search results.
